Mission
The Resilience, Education and Access for Community Health (REACH) Committee strives to disseminate evidence-based mental health information to communities, with the overarching goal of reducing stigma and increasing mental health literacy. We promote the lay-friendly communication of empirically supported mental health topics to maximize outreach to all. Guided by scientific-mindedness and an understanding of the importance of mental health literacy, we are dedicated to bringing our clinical and scientific work, along with real-world implications, to the communities we serve.
